According to Fabrizio Romano, Inter have officially submitted a proposal worth more than €20 million (£17m/$22m) to Lens for 22-year-old midfielder Diouf. The Nerazzurri made their move after their attempt to sign Kone from fell through. Napoli had already seen a €20m package rejected by Lens, while side Palace also showed interest. Inter are in direct talks with Diouf’s camp over personal terms.

The French midfielder has attracted strong interest this summer, but Lens have stood firm on their valuation. The club recently signed Mamadou Sangare from for €8m, a move that could pave the way for Diouf’s departure. The giants, needing a midfield reinforcement to balance their squad, see him as a key target. With Napoli and Premier League clubs circling, Inter are trying to move quickly to secure his signature.

Diouf, who joined Lens from in 2023, registered one goal and two assists in 34 Ligue 1 appearances last season and remains under contract until June 2028. Napoli had already offered him a deal but saw their bid rejected, while Palace also showed concrete interest earlier this summer. Lens’ move for Sangare suggests they are prepared for Diouf’s departure.

Inter’s latest bid could give them an edge over Gli Azzurri and the Eagles, but Lens are holding out for maximum value. With the transfer window entering its final stretch, Inter must now reach an agreement on personal terms with Diouf to avoid another missed signing.
